Question 205199: Hello I need help figuring out this equation involving radicals. I need to solve the equation and check for extraneious solutions.
√a-1-5=1
I get a=-1 but I don't think that is right.
Answer by ankor@dixie-net.com(22740)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
√a-1-5=1
Assume the problem is:
= 1
Add 5 to both sides
= 1 + 5
= 6
Square both sides
a - 1 = 36
:
a = 36 + 1
a = 37
;
:
Check solution in original equation
= 1
= 1
6 - 5 = 1
